NOW is the time to join The Better Food Company! We’re looking for someone to provide maintenance and repair of the plant’s machinery, grounds, buildings and equipment. This is the entry‑level position in the maintenance classification and is expected to perform the job functions under minimal supervision.

Sign-On Bonus Up to $6,000: $3,000 paid after 90 days of full‑time employment with no attendance or performance issues, and $3,000 paid after 6 months of full‑time employment with no attendance or performance issues.

Schedule This position will work 6 days per week, 3 pm – 11 pm.

Responsibilities The responsibilities include:

Evaluate and identify potential problems, repair and maintain electrical/mechanical machinery and equipment.

Evaluate and identify potential problems, repair and maintain pneumatic, hydraulic, HVAC and plumbing systems inside and outside the plant.

Install new and/or relocate old equipment.

Perform necessary repairs and maintenance to buildings and grounds as advised.

Cleans and repairs boilers; identify and overhauls crane systems.

Complete preventative maintenance as assigned and complete required documentation.

TIG welding with mild steel and/or stainless steel.

Participate in project improvements and team meetings.

Ensure regular attendance per company policy.

Perform other duties assigned by Management.

Safety

Maintain highest standard of safety for all functions and ensure compliance with OSHA standards.

Perform daily inspection of all required PPE (slip‑resistant/steel‑toed shoes, safety glasses, gloves, shields, aprons) to ensure good overall condition.

Acquire and maintain company industrial truck and lift certification and perform all functions in accordance with OSHA and company standards.

Perform proper housekeeping and use appropriate personal protective equipment.

Perform daily inspection of equipment with proper documentation.

Quality

Maintain company standards for cleanliness, food and equipment safety, and efficient productivity.

Perform all required inspections of equipment and products per specification with proper documentation.

Ensure compliance with quality, food safety and HACCP support programs; assure conformity to all company, customer and government standards.

Teamwork

Effectively communicate verbally and in writing with team members and management.

Work respectfully with all team members to ensure safety, quality, production and support of our products and goals daily.

Actively participate in department/shift/team meetings and contribute suggestions for improvement.

Functions

Practice integrity, respect, accountability, continuous improvement and positive interactions with all team members and visitors.

Identify potential problems, repair and maintain equipment as listed above.

Assist with team meetings with all coworkers.

Perform other duties as assigned by management.

Qualifications

Mechanical aptitude and accurate troubleshooting ability are required, preferably in a food manufacturing environment.

Ability to work independently and as part of a team with minimal supervision.

Must obtain industrial truck and lift operating certification and maintain it per company and OSHA standards.

Demonstrated ability to communicate effectively, both verbally and in writing, with team members, management, customers and vendors.

Working knowledge of manufacturing equipment operation, ability to use accurate tools and good math skills.

Ability to read and interpret written and verbal direction while working safely and productively in a fast‑paced environment.

Minimum of a high school diploma or GED required; an industrial maintenance degree preferred.

Must pass a proficiency test with a minimum score of 80 %.

Working Conditions/Environment The role is in a manufacturing environment that requires speaking, reading, comprehending, sitting, standing, walking, reaching, lifting, grasping, climbing and bending. Must be able to push/pull 150 lbs short distances and lift up to 75 lbs repetitively. Standing required for up to 12‑hour shifts with regular breaks. May be required to work overtime and/or weekends as needed. Employees are regularly exposed to heat, fumes, odors, dust, oil, slippery floors, moving parts/equipment and non‑toxic industrial waste and scrap. The noise level in the plant is loud. Required PPE: slip‑resistant/steel‑toed shoes, earplugs, safety glasses, hairnets, beard nets (if facial hair) in accordance with GMP and safety standards.
